Windows and Doors: A Comprehensive Guide to Selection, Maintenance, and Trends
Windows and doors play an important function in both the aesthetic appeal and functionality of a home. They act as barriers against the components, supply security, and develop openings for ventilation and light. Understanding the various types, materials, and upkeep practices associated with doors and windows can considerably boost a residential or commercial property's value and convenience.

Selecting Windows and Doors
Products to Consider
- Wood: Known for its aesthetics, wood is a traditional option however requires routine maintenance.
- Vinyl: This material is low maintenance and energy-efficient, withstanding peeling and fading.
- Aluminum: Durable and light-weight, aluminum doors and windows are perfect for modern-day designs.
- Fiberglass: Highly long lasting and energy-efficient, fiberglass can mimic wood without the maintenance.
Energy Efficiency Ratings
When picking doors and windows, energy effectiveness is vital. Try to find:
- U-Factor: Measures the rate of heat transfer. Lower worths are better.
-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C): Indicates how well an item blocks heat from sunlight. Lower values are preferred in warm climates.
- Visible Transmittance (VT): Assesses how much light passes through. Greater worths allow more light.

Upkeep Tips
To extend the life of doors and windows, routine upkeep is necessary. Here are some valuable pointers:
- Cleaning: Use moderate cleaning agent and soft cloths for cleaning up glass surfaces.
- Sealing: Check seals around windows and doors each year to avoid air leakages.
- Lubrication: Apply silicone spray to hinges, locks, and sliding systems routinely.
- Examination: Look for indications of wetness damage, wear, or decay, particularly in wood components.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How often should doors and windows be changed?
A: Windows and doors have differing lifespans however normally require replacement every 15-30 years, depending upon material and maintenance.
Q2: What are the advantages of setting up energy-efficient windows?
A: Energy-efficient windows can significantly lower heating and cooling costs, enhance comfort, and improve the home's value.
Q3: Can I set up doors and windows myself?
A: While it's possible, expert setup is recommended to make sure proper fit and sealing, preserving service warranties.
Q4: What should I think about when selecting front doors?
A: Consider curb appeal, security functions, insulation homes, and the total architectural style of your home.

Q5: How do I preserve vinyl windows?
A: Vinyl windows need very little maintenance; simply clean with soapy water and check seals regularly for wear.
